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| blunt tellin | Lesser Treefrog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Mollusca (Mollusks)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Bivalvia (Bivalvia)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Cardiida (Cardiida)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Tellinidae | Hylidae |
| Genus | Arcopagia | Dendropsophus |
| Species | Arcopagia crassa | Dendropsophus minutus |

Habitat & Geographic Range
blunt tellin
Native to Europe, inhabiting ecosystems characteristic of the region.
Distributed across Belgium, Denmark, Norway, and Sweden. Currently classified as Vulnerable on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.
Lesser Treefrog
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ands.
Found in Venezuela.
